On October 12-18, at least 8 persons suffered in armed conflict in Northern Caucasus

During the week of October 12-18, 2015, at least 8 persons suffered in the armed conflict in Northern Caucasus. Of them, seven persons were killed, and one person was wounded. These are the results of the calculations run by the "Caucasian Knot" based on its own materials and information from other open sources.

According to the law enforcement bodies, all the victims were suspected members of the armed underground. Of them, four were killed in Dagestan and three in Ingushetia.

Special and counterterrorist operations

On October 12, the counterterrorist operation (CTO) legal regime was introduced in the town of Karabulak and in a number of villages of the Nazran District of Ingushetia, including Ekazhevo, Plievo, Barsuki, Gazi-Yurt, and Yandare. In two private houses in the village of Gazi-Yurt, law enforcers blocked suspected members of an illegal armed formation (IAF). In the course of the shootout, three members of IAFs were killed. According to the preliminary information, they were members of the "Nazran" criminal grouping. Two of the killed men were identified as 25-year-old Aslan Dyshnoev and 28-year-old Magomed Pliev from the federal wanted list.

Four residents of Ingushetia were detained for the check of their involvement in aiding and abetting the IAF. On October 13, an improvised explosive device (IED) with power of about 10 kg of TNT equivalent was found in a VAZ-2114 car. According to the preliminary information of law enforcers, the IED belonged to the members of the armed underground killed in the special operation. On October 13, the CTO legal regime was cancelled in the Nazran District of Ingushetia and Karabulak.

On October 12, the CTO legal regime was cancelled in the village of Gimry of the Untsukul District of Dagestan, where law enforcers launched a special operation on October 10.

On October 13, the CTO legal regime was introduced within the territory of the Tsumada District of Dagestan. According to local residents, the special activities of law enforcers were concentrated in the village of Kvanada, and then the law enforcers moved to the nearby forest. The local residents reported that the law enforcers took away from the village the man whose son was hiding from the law enforcement bodies. On October 18, the CTO legal regime was cancelled.

On October 15, the CTO legal regime was introduced within the territory of the Derbent District of Dagestan. Law enforcers organized searches for members of a local militants' grouping, involved in a number of crimes, including the murder of the fortuneteller and her family members in September.

On October 17, the CTO legal regime was introduced in three villages of the Khasavyurt District of Dagestan, including Batayurt, Novy Kurush, and Sadovoe and within the territory between them. In the course of the special operation, a shootout occurred between law enforcers and suspected militants. As a result, four men were killed. The deceased men are identified as 28-year-old Alkhas Sardarov, Rasul Sardarov, Yasim Batraev, and Djumart Shikhragimov. A Russian FSB special forces fighter was wounded during the armed clash. The CTO legal regime was cancelled on October 17.

Detentions

On October 10, Patakh Arumagomedov, Gusein Shikhamirov, and Gairbek Khapizov, three residents of the village of Gimry of the Untsukul District of Dagestan were detained in the course of the CTO, and their houses were searched. The detainees are "involved in the case as persons suspected of aiding and abetting militants."

On October 13, during the operational activities in Grozny, law enforcers detained a suspected accomplice of a grouping of militants, destroyed in the Staropromyslovsky District of Grozny on October 8. One more suspected member of the criminal grouping is wanted, reports a source from the Dagestani law enforcement bodies.

Disappearance

At night of September 23, Rashid Magomedov, a resident of the Botlikh District of Dagestan, left home in his black Lada Priora car. Since that time, his whereabouts is unknown. Rashid Magomedov is a disabled person: he lost his left hand. In 2012, Rashid Magomedov was registered at the police station as a follower of Salafism. Family members of Rashid Magomedov suggest that he could be again detained by law enforcers, and they filed complaints about the Rashid's disappearance to the Botlikh ROVD (District Interior Division) and to the Dagestani Ministry of Internal Affairs (MIA).

Personalities
Zelimkhan Khangoshvili. Photo courtesy of press service of HRC 'Memorial', http://memohrc.org/ Zelimkhan Khangoshvili

A participant of the second Chechen military campaign, one of the field commanders close to Shamil Basaev and Aslan Maskhadov. Shot dead in Berlin in 2019.

Magomed Daudov. Photo: screenshot of the video http://video.agaclip.com/w=atDtPvLYH9o Magomed Daudov

Magomed "Lord" Daudov is a former Chechen militant who was awarded the title of "Hero of Russia", the chairman of the Chechen parliament under Ramzan Kadyrov.

Tumso Abdurakhmanov. Screenshot from video posted by Abu-Saddam Shishani [LIVE] http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=mIR3s7AB0Uw Tumso Abdurakhmanov

Tumso Abdurakhmanov is a blogger from Chechnya. After a conflict with Ramzan Kadyrov's relative, he left the republic and went first to Georgia, and then to Poland, where he is trying to get political asylum.
